How to Choose the Best Laptop for Psychology Students in 2026?
As a psychology student, your laptop needs differ from engineering or gaming students. You’ll primarily use your computer for research, writing papers, statistical analysis, and online learning. Here’s what matters most:
Processing Power: You don’t need a gaming laptop, but enough power for multitasking is crucial. An Intel Core i3 or AMD Ryzen 3 handles basic tasks, while Core i5 or Ryzen 5 processors excel at running SPSS, R, or multiple browser tabs simultaneously.
RAM Requirements: 8GB is the sweet spot for psychology students. It allows smooth operation of Microsoft Office, web browsers, and basic statistical software. If you plan to use advanced research tools or virtual reality applications for cognitive studies, consider 16GB.
Storage Solutions: A 256GB SSD provides fast boot times and enough space for documents, research papers, and course materials. Cloud storage through your university often supplements local storage needs.
Battery Life: Psychology students spend long days on campus. Look for laptops offering 8+ hours of real-world battery life to avoid hunting for outlets between classes.
Build Quality: Your laptop will travel daily in backpacks and survive lecture halls. Solid construction and reliable keyboards matter more than flashy designs.
Common Psychology Student Laptop Mistakes to Avoid
Don’t fall for these expensive traps that drain student budgets without adding value. Many psychology students overspend on gaming features they’ll never use, like dedicated graphics cards or high-refresh displays. Your tuition money is better invested in reliable basics.
Skipping warranty protection is another costly mistake. Student laptops face daily wear from constant transport. Extended warranties or accident protection plans often cost less than a single repair.
Finally, don’t choose style over substance. That ultra-thin laptop might look impressive in the coffee shop, but if it can’t last through back-to-back classes or handle your research needs, you’ll regret the purchase during finals week.

FAQ
What’s the minimum specs needed for psychology coursework?
For basic psychology coursework, aim for at least 8GB RAM, 256GB storage, and a modern processor (Intel Core i3 or AMD Ryzen 3 minimum). This handles research, writing, and basic statistical software without issues.
Q: Can these laptops run SPSS or R for statistics?
A: Yes, most Windows laptops in our list run SPSS, R, and other statistical software. The Lenovo V15 Business and ASUS Vivobook S 15 handle complex analyses best, while Chromebooks require web-based alternatives like Google Sheets or Jamovi online.
Q: Is a touchscreen necessary for psychology students?
A: While not essential, touchscreens enhance productivity for note-taking, annotating research papers, and navigating documents. The HP Chromebook Plus x360 and Dell Inspiron 2-in-1 excel at digital note-taking with their convertible designs.
How much storage do psychology students typically need?
256GB covers most psychology students’ needs, especially with cloud storage from your university. If you plan to store video interviews, large datasets, or multimedia content locally, consider 512GB or 1TB options.
Should psychology students choose Windows, macOS, or Chrome OS?
Windows offers the broadest software compatibility for psychology programs. macOS provides excellent build quality but costs more. Chrome OS works well for students primarily using web-based tools and Google Workspace.
